Saint Thomas More Scholarship at Belmont Abbey College, USA 2012-2013
13.10.2011
Students who have the courage of moral conviction and an interest in majoring in History, Political Philosophy, Theology, English, Modern and Classical Languages, or the Fine Arts, may qualify for this scholarship. Early Decision Value: $20,000 per year Recipients of this distinguished and highly-competitive award can receive up to $20,000 per year in financial assistance. (This offer is inclusive of all other scholarship and grants offered through Belmont Abbey College.) Regular Decision Value: $17,000 per year Recipients of this distinguished and highly-competitive award can receive up to $17,000 per year in financial assistance. (This offer is inclusive of all other scholarship and grants offered through Belmont Abbey College.).
NASA Langley Aerospace Research Summer Scholars Program, USA-2011-2012
13.10.2011
The Langley Aerospace Research Summer Scholars (LARSS) Program is one of NASA’s most successful student programs, for 25 years providing mentored, paid, research internships to undergraduate and graduate students in the fields of Science, Technoloy,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M) as well as in Business, Communication, Marketing, and other areas that support NASA’s mission.NASA LaRC invites rising undergraduate juniors and seniors, and graduate students who are pursuing degrees in Science, Technology, Engineering (most fields, particularly aeronautical, electrical, chemical, and mechanical), Mathematics, materials science, atmospheric science and other aerospace-related fields, as well as other majors that lend support to NASA’s mission in special project areas such as accounting, business, public administration, English, journalism, history, photography and media arts to apply for the LARSS program. Females and students from underrepresented groups are encouraged to apply.

2012 NOAA Climate and Global Change Postdoctoral Fellowship Program, USA
12.10.2011
UCAR provides Postdoctoral Fellowship in the field of Climate and Global Change at USA Research Institution. The program pairs recently graduated PhDs with host scientists at U.S. institutions to work in an area of mutual interest. The program aims to create the next generation of climate researchers. The NOAA Climate and Global Change Postdoctoral Fellowships focus on observing, understanding, modeling, and predicting climate variability and change on seasonal and longer time scales. This includes the documentation and analysis of past, current, or possible future climate variability and change and the study of the underlying physical, chemical, and biological processes.
AMS/Industry Minority Scholarships for Minority Students, USA
12.10.2011
The AMS/Industry Minority Scholarships will award funding to minority students who have been traditionally underrepresented in the sciences, especially Hispanic, Native American, and Black/African American students. The American Meteorological Society (AMS) Minority Scholarships help support the college educations of minority students traditionally underrepresented in the sciences, especially Hispanic, Native American, and Black/African American students, who intend to pursue careers in the atmospheric or related oceanic and hydrologic sciences. The two-year scholarships, funded by industry and through donations made by members to the AMS 21st Century Campaign, are for $3000 for a nine-month period in the freshman year and an additional $3000 for a nine-month period in the sophomore year.
Master’s Student Minority Scholarship and the Minority Supervision Stipend Program, USA
11.10.2011
The American Association for Marriage and Family Therapy (AAMFT) Research and Education Foundation announces a call for applications for the Master’s Student Minority Scholarship and Minority Supervision Stipend Program for the 2011-2012 academic year. The AAMFT Research and Education Foundation and the AAMFT Awards Committee is pleased to offer minorities of diverse racial and ethnic backgrounds the opportunity to pursue training for the profession of marriage and family therapy. Each year, the Foundation will provide: 1) up to three scholarships to master’s level minority students (per recipient: up to $2,000; a plaque; and funding to attend the conference, not including the pre-conference institute) 2) up to two stipends to minority supervisors-in-training (per recipient: waiver of supervision application processing fee; up to $750 to offset the cost of supervision; conference registration fee waived, not including pre-conference institute).

National Federation of the Blind 2012 Scholarship Program for Degree Programs, USA
11.10.2011
National Federation of the Blind provide 2012 Scholarship Program to pursue a full-time, Post Secondary course of study in a degree program at a United States in the field of any subject. To recognize achievement by blind scholars, the National Federation of the Blind annually offers blind college students in the United States the opportunity to win one of thirty national scholarships worth from $3,000 to $12,000.
2011–2012 The New York Times College Scholarship Program, USA
10.10.2011
The New York Times Company and a gift from the Starr Foundation provide Graduate Scholarship for U.S. citizens in USA in the field of subjects offered by the university. Up to eight high school seniors will be selected to receive four-year scholarships for a maximum of $7,500 annually to attend any nationally accredited four-year college to which they have been admitted for full-time study. Students will also receive a summer internship at The New York Times, educational and job counseling, mentoring, cultural experiences and a laptop. The students will receive their scholarship funding from The New York Times Company Foundation, public contributions and an endowment fund, supported primarily by a gift from the Starr Foundation.
